Do corporations have First Amendment rights, and if so, how are these rights protected and exercised in the United States?

Yes, corporations have First Amendment rights, which include freedom of speech, religion, and assembly. These rights are protected and exercised through legal challenges, lobbying efforts, and participation in political activities such as campaign contributions and advertising.

What amendment allows the burning of the US flag?

It is protected under the First Amendment under the principle of freedom of speech. However, there have been numerous votes for Anti-Flag Burning amendments in the House and Senate in recent years.

What protects the right to make views known by petition letters lobbying picketing or marching?

The right to express views through petitioning, lobbying, picketing, or marching is protected by the First Amendment of the United States Constitution. This amendment guarantees the freedoms of speech, assembly, and the right to petition the government for redress of grievances. These protections ensure that individuals can collectively express opinions and advocate for change without fear of government retaliation.
